1/*
2 * Driver for AMD7930 sound chips found on Sparcs.
3 * Copyright (C) 2002, 2008 David S. Miller <davem@davemloft.net>
4 *
5 * Based entirely upon drivers/sbus/audio/amd7930.c which is:
6 * Copyright (C) 1996,1997 Thomas K. Dyas (tdyas@eden.rutgers.edu)
7 *
8 * --- Notes from Thomas's original driver ---
9 * This is the lowlevel driver for the AMD7930 audio chip found on all
10 * sun4c machines and some sun4m machines.
11 *
12 * The amd7930 is actually an ISDN chip which has a very simple
13 * integrated audio encoder/decoder. When Sun decided on what chip to
14 * use for audio, they had the brilliant idea of using the amd7930 and
15 * only connecting the audio encoder/decoder pins.
16 *
17 * Thanks to the AMD engineer who was able to get us the AMD79C30
18 * databook which has all the programming information and gain tables.
19 *
20 * Advanced Micro Devices' Am79C30A is an ISDN/audio chip used in the
21 * SparcStation 1+.  The chip provides microphone and speaker interfaces
22 * which provide mono-channel audio at 8K samples per second via either
23 * 8-bit A-law or 8-bit mu-law encoding.  Also, the chip features an
24 * ISDN BRI Line Interface Unit (LIU), I.430 S/T physical interface,
25 * which performs basic D channel LAPD processing and provides raw
26 * B channel data.  The digital audio channel, the two ISDN B channels,
27 * and two 64 Kbps channels to the microprocessor are all interconnected
28 * via a multiplexer.
29 * --- End of notes from Thoamas's original driver ---
30 */

110/* The amd7930 has "indirect registers" which are accessed by writing
111 * the register number into the Command Register and then reading or
112 * writing values from the Data Register as appropriate. We define the
113 * AMR_* macros to be the indirect register numbers and AM_* macros to
114 * be bits in whatever register is referred to.
115 */
